I have a 2011 VW Jetta, 1.6 TDI, 105 HP, which occasionally goes into limp mode as soon as I turn the ignition on. This happens before the engine is started. If I start the engine, switch it off, and then restart it, the error disappears. I should mention that this fault has never occurred under load or while driving.
The diagnostic tool shows the following fault code:
P023600 - Turbocharger Boost Sensor
At first, the fault appeared only rarely, about once every three months. Recently, however, it has started occurring more and more often, which is why I began looking into it.
From what I have read, when the ignition is switched on, the ECU performs an initialization procedure. It seems that sometimes my sensor reports a pressure value higher than atmospheric pressure during this process. For this reason, I replaced only the sensor, but the fault did not disappear.
I then took the car to a mechanic, and the following work was carried out in several stages:
- EGR and DPF cleaning. The fault remained.
- Turbocharger cleaning. The fault disappeared for about three weeks, but then started occurring again.
So my question is: has anyone else experienced this fault? If so, how did you solve it?
